Pasty & Cider 'Call In' concert Saturday 30 October 2021

An informal musical get together was held in the church with a wide range of pieces being played on the organ by Lynne Sullivan our resident Tetcott organist and Christine March from Ashwater.  £190 was raised towards church funds

Remembrance Sunday

14 November 2021

The remembrance service at Tetcott was well attended. Members of the community read parts of the service including the names of those remembered on the monument. Wreaths were laid by 2 of one of our church wardens grandchildren and the chairman of the parish council before a 2 minutes silence was observed.

Following the service another wreath was laid by the tree planted in 2006 by veterans of HMS Tetcott.

Christmas Crafts

27 November 2021

Our Christmas craft morning was well attended by local children. They enjoyed exploring the church, making Christmas decorations and helping to decorate the church. A tombola stall raised money for the local mother and toddler group.
